Output 10efe1776cfadd2af1f350bc7a00a1b548fcf01fce93cb3f6c76b5f9e9852d91:0

value
21844555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5938ad26e08831daf3305b4e2e97004d6165021e OP_EQUAL
address
39pmxZSkbzefXw7DubKM6FgQbjp5TYiwXg
transaction
10efe1776cfadd2af1f350bc7a00a1b548fcf01fce93cb3f6c76b5f9e9852d91
confirmations
566872
spent
true